Palmieri Stays Put: The Details of the Deal
The Islanders have officially signed Kyle Palmieri to a two-year contract extension. While the exact financial terms were initially undisclosed, reports later surfaced indicating an annual average value of $4.75 million. This commitment ensures that the 34-year-old forward will continue to don the blue and orange for the foreseeable future.
Palmieri is coming off a solid season where he tallied 48 points (24 goals, 24 assists) in 82 games. His contributions were crucial to the Islanders' offensive efforts, finishing third on the team in both goals and points. He also tied for the team lead with five power-play goals, showcasing his versatility and importance in key situations. Securing Palmieri prevents him from becoming an unrestricted free agent on July 1, a move that would have left a hole in the Islanders' forward corps.
Boqvist Joins the Blue Line
In addition to Palmieri, the Islanders also inked defenseman Adam Boqvist to a one-year deal. While details surrounding Boqvist's contract are still emerging, his addition provides depth and potential to the team's defensive unit. This move suggests that new GM Darche is looking to bolster the roster on both ends of the ice.
